The aim of this Degree in Primary Education is to ensure the pedagogical, psychological, linguistic, sociological, scientific, technological and artistic training of future primary education teachers (6-12 years).

Career opportunities:

  • Teaching: training in primary education centres, teacher in penal centres, teacher in hospitals, teacher in NGOs, foundations, etc.
  • Consultancy: consultancy in planning and design of educational games, elaboration of didactic material.
  • Socio-cultural activities: educational support services for schools (museums, municipalities, work camps...), leisure time education, intervention in childcare programmes; planning, design and development of extracurricular and recreational-festive activities, etc.
